Book now for REHAU District Heating workshop

REHAU’s free District Heating workshops will be heading to Dynamic Earth in Edinburgh on October 4 to offer consultants, contractors, local authorities, developers and housing associations the chance to find out more about the benefits and practicalities of district heating.

This will be the last in a popular series of events where attendees will hear presentations from a line-up of industry experts and take part in breakout sessions to discuss topics in further depth. There will also be a talk pertaining to a case study, so delegates can understand how district heating works not just in theory, but in practice too. 

Steve Richmond, head of marketing and technical for the Building Solutions division, said: “There are lots of people out there that want to know about district heating, and our workshops offer them expert advice and information all in one day. We’ve refreshed the delivery of the workshops a little from last year, breaking content down into smaller segments, and adding in new breakout workshops so delegates can get more involved in the discussions.”

Building on the success of its events held last year, REHAU is holding District Heating workshops around the UK and Ireland throughout 2017.

The last event in the series of workshops is to take place from 9am until 2pm at Dynamic Earth, Ozone Biosphere, Holyrood Road, Edinburgh, EH8 8AS.
